Understanding UK Gambling Licences and Their Importance
When evaluating an online casino’s trustworthiness, the first and most critical factor out is its licensing status. In the UK, the only if legitimate regulatory body is the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), which enforces some of the strictest standards in the industry. A UKGC licence ensures that the casino operates under stringent rules regarding player protection, fair gaming, and anti-money laundering measures. Before signing up, e’er verify the licence number on the UKGC website and check the operator’s terms for clarity on dispute resolution. Casinos without a UKGC licence or those holding offshore permits like Malta or Curacao should be approached with utmost caution, as they do not offer the same level of regulatory oversight or financial safeguards for UK players. The presence of a valid UKGC licence is your primary assurance that the casino adheres to legal requirements and can be held accountable for any misconduct. For example, the UKGC mandates that all operators must contribute to GambleAware and participate in the self-exclusion scheme GAMSTOP, providing additional layers of protection. Moreover, licensed casinos are subject to regular audits and must posit detailed reports on their financial health, ensuring they can pay out winnings. In contrast, offshore licences often lack such rigorous inadvertence, leaving players vulnerable to unfair practices or even outright fraud. Therefore, always prioritise UKGC-licensed casinos and double-check the licence details on the official register to avoid rogue operators that might showing imitation credentials.
Assessing Security Measures and Data Protection
Security is paramount when choosing an virtual casino, as you will be sharing sensitive personal and financial information. Top-tier UK casinos employ advanced SSL encryption (128-flake or 256-bit) to protect data during transmission, and they should clearly exhibit their certificate protocols in their concealment policy. Hunt for casinos that have been independently audited by organisations ilk eCOGRA or iTech Labs, which verify the fairness of games and the integrity of random number generators. Additionally, reputable operators offer two-factor authentication (2FA) for account logins and withdrawals, adding an special layer of protection. Review whether the casino has a robust data protection insurance that complies with UK GDPR regulations. If a site lacks clear security information or uses obsolete encryption, it is not worth risking your money or identity. For instance, a trustworthy casino will explicitly state its encryption standards and may still display security department badges from trusted vendors. It is also wise to review the casino’s privacy policy to understand how your data is stored, used, and shared with tertiary parties. Some casinos go further by offering cyber insurance or partnering with cybersecurity firms to conduct regular vulnerability assessments. In the event of a data breach, a reputable operator will notify affected players promptly and provide guidance on protective measures. By prioritising security, you minimise the risk of identity element theft and financial loss, making it a non-negotiable criterion in your selection process.
Evaluating Payout Reliability and Game Fairness
Payout reliability straight impacts your overall experience and trust in a casino. This refers to how promptly and accurately the casino processes withdrawals, as fountainhead as the fairness of its games. UK-licensed casinos are required to maintain segregated user funds, meaning your deposits are kept separate from operating funds, ensuring you can always withdraw your winnings. Look for casinos with a proven track record of fast payouts, typically within 24-72 hours for e-wallets and 3-5 business days for bank transfers. Game fairness is verified through published Return to Player (RTP) percentages and independent audit reports. Reputable developer providers like NetEnt, Microgaming, and Playtech are known for their transparent RTPs and rigorous testing.

The Cornerstones of Trustworthy Licensing and Security
When Canadian players begin their look for a reliable online casino, the very first element they must scrutinise is the licensing and surety framework. In Canada, there is no federal gambling regulator; instead, provinces and territories manage their have regimes, and many reputable online casinos serving Canadian players sustain licences from the Alcohol and Gaming Commission of Ontario (AGCO) for the province of Ontario, or from the Kahnawake Gaming Commission (KGC) for operations based in the Mohawk Territory of Kahnawake. These bodies enforce rigorous standards for player protection, game fairness, and financial transparency. A licence from the AGCO or the KGC signals that the casino has undergone thorough background checks and must hold fast to strict codes of conduct. For instance, AGCO licensees are required to participate in the province’s iGaming market, which mandates responsible gambling tools like PlaySmart, while KGC licensees must follow with its Technical Standards for gaming systems, which ensure random outcomes and data integrity. Beyond the licence itself, certificate measures are paramount. Every trustworthy casino should employ 128-fleck or 256-flake SSL encryption to protect all data transfers between the player and the site. This encryption ensures that personal details such as names, addresses, and banking info remain inaccessible to unauthorised parties. Additionally, look for casinos that have their games and random list generators (RNGs) audited by independent third-party testing agencies same eCOGRA, iTech Labs, or GLI (Gaming Laboratories International). An audit certificate or seal on the website indicates that the games are truly random and that the stated return-to-player percentages are accurate. Many players overlook these details, but they are the bedrock of a safe gambling environment. A casino that cannot clearly display its licence number, encryption details, and audit certifications should be viewed with great suspicion. Furthermore, responsible gambling tools such as de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and reality checks are also hallmarks of a licensed and ethical operator. For example, Ontario-licensed casinos must offer a mandatory deposit limit upon signup, while KGC-regulated sites are required to provide links to problem gambling helplines and allow players to set session time limits. When evaluating a casino, take the time to visit the footer of the website—often the licence and security entropy is posted there. If it is missing or vague, that is a cherry-red flag. In summary, the first step in any casino review is to verify that the operator holds a valid licence from a recognised Canadian or provincial say-so, uses robust encryption, and submits to regular independent audits. Without these fundamental principle, no amount of attractive bonuses or title variety can urinate up for the increased risk to your funds and personal data.

Setting Limits: A Guide to Safer Gambling in 2026
Gambling is stringently for adults aged 18 and over. All UK-licensed casinos are regulated by the Gambling Commission (UKGC) to guarantee fair and safe play. If you feel your gambling is decorous a problem, you can use the national self-exclusion connive GAMSTOP to block access to all UK operators. For confidential help and support, touch GamCare or BeGambleAware via the National Gambling Helpline on 0808 8020 133. Always mark deposit and time limits before you play, and treat gambling as entertainment – never as a way to make money or recover losses.
